Data Center Cooling System Requirements
Modern data centers demand sophisticated cooling systems that can handle substantial heat loads while maintaining precise environmental control. The water storage components must meet exceptionally high standards for reliability, water quality, and system integrity.
| Cooling System Type | Water Storage Requirements | Critical Parameters |
|---|---|---|
| Chilled Water Systems | Thermal storage, buffer tanks, expansion control | Temperature stability, corrosion resistance |
| Evaporative Cooling | Make-up water storage, treatment systems | Water quality, microbial control |
| Liquid Immersion Cooling | Dielectric fluid storage, heat exchange | Chemical compatibility, purity |
| Hybrid Systems | Multiple storage configurations | System integration, redundancy |
GRP Tank Advantages for Data Center Applications
GRP panel tanks offer unique benefits that make them particularly suitable for data center environments where reliability and longevity are critical.
Corrosion Resistance
Unlike metal tanks, GRP panels are completely immune to rust and corrosion, ensuring long-term water quality and system integrity in chemically treated cooling water systems.
Thermal Efficiency
GRP materials provide excellent thermal insulation properties, reducing heat gain/loss and improving overall cooling system efficiency.
Water Quality Maintenance
Non-porous surfaces prevent biofilm formation and bacterial growth, maintaining water purity in critical cooling applications.
Seismic Resilience
GRP panel tanks offer superior flexibility and shock absorption compared to rigid materials, providing enhanced seismic performance for data centers in active zones.

Preventive Maintenance Strategies
Proactive maintenance ensures the long-term reliability of GRP panel tanks in critical data center applications.
| Maintenance Activity | Frequency | Critical Checks |
|---|---|---|
| Daily Visual Inspection | Daily | Leak detection, water level verification |
| Water Quality Testing | Weekly | Chemical balance, microbial content |
| System Performance Review | Monthly | Flow rates, temperature differentials |
| Comprehensive Inspection | Annually | Structural integrity, component wear |
